DingoLadd Posted November 7, 2017 Share Posted November 7, 2017 6 minutes ago, pheltzbahr said: Ha! And yes, I would! Alright let's start with the obvious, QB situations. Portland possess a top 12 QB in Derek Carr who is fully capable of beating an elite defense with the weapons portland has, Gotham despite possessing two of the best CBs in BDL is susceptible to the pass due fo the fact they don't really have the personell to eliminate Portland's RBs from the passing game. . Austin Hooper is also a decent weapon though Sammy Watkins will more or less get erased by whoever covers him. I can see Davante Adams doing some damage against Rhodes for the tune of 5-65 Portland's 3rd WR is entirely irrelevant for much of the game though. Gotham has a front seven fully capable of shutting down most team's run games but you can't exactly focus on it with Derek Carr back there and he'll eventually make Gotham pay for focusing too much on the RBs. I expect Carr would be under a large amount of pressure though and IMO that would normally swing things to Gotham's side but Wentz's o-line isn't the best either and I'd expect Kawann Short to live in the backfield most of the game and portland would win on the inside for the majority of the game and putting tons of pressure on Wentz as well. Basically it came down to which team could do more offensiveley and outside of Thomas, Davis, Landry Gotham has no weapons to take advantage of Portland's weaknesses on defense. I don't think Davis does much against Portland's LBs or safeties while Thomas is dealing with Jimmy Smith and some double coverage. Landry taking on Joeseph is a matchup he can win but outside of that I see Portland more or less shutting down Gotham's entire offense for the majority of the game and forcing Wentz to win it with his arm. Wentz is fully capable of doing that but he can't throw it to Landry/Thomas/Davis and expect that to work the entire game. TDLR: Portland can use their RBs to get a decent running game going and supplement their passing offense which would struggle against an elite secondary normally. 23-20 Portland.
